March through May is perfect - wildflowers bloom in the mountains, temperatures hover around 70°F, and you can hike without melting. September through November offers the same sweet spot with bonus: fewer crowds and clearer mountain views after summer haze clears. Summer gets hot during the day but those mountain evenings are magic - just expect every European tourist to be here too. Winter brings rain and temperatures that dip into the 40s, but also dramatic cloud formations over the Rif Mountains and rock-bottom hotel prices. Avoid July and August unless you enjoy fighting for photo spots and paying peak-season prices. The shoulder seasons give you the best of everything: good weather, reasonable crowds, and locals who have time to chat instead of just processing tourist hordes.
